What is Invest-like?
Invest-like is a stock-analysis tool that scores every public company against documented value-investing frameworks — Warren Buffett, Benjamin Graham, Peter Lynch, and Joel Greenblatt — and returns a clear Yes / No / Maybe verdict with the reasoning. 12,000+ tickers, refreshed daily, no finance degree required.
What Invest-like does
Invest-like takes the criteria value investors actually use — wide economic moat, durable demand, owner-friendly management, balance-sheet quality, return on invested capital, earnings yield, margin of safety — and applies them to every stock in the public market. Then it returns one of three verdicts:
- YESThe stock passes the framework's full filter — strong moat, clean balance sheet, fair-or-better valuation.
- MAYBEMixed — passes some criteria, fails others. The page explains exactly which.
- NOFails the framework — usually for a specific reason worth understanding, even if you don't act on it.

How Invest-like works under the hood
Fundamentals come from Financial Modeling Prep (annual + quarterly filings, 10+ years of history). Quotes refresh daily; intraday prices are delayed. The framework verdicts are AI-generated using structured prompts that mirror the rubrics value investors apply manually — moat strength, durability of demand, management quality, financial health, and price-vs-intrinsic value. Each verdict is cached with a prompt version, so you can always see which logic produced which answer.
The site runs on Next.js 15 + Supabase, deployed from Frankfurt (eu-central-1) on Vercel. GDPR-friendly defaults: no third-party cookies, no fingerprinting, masked input capture only.
What Invest-like is not
- Not personalised advice. Verdicts are pattern-matches against documented public frameworks, not buy/sell recommendations.
- Not a brokerage. Invest-like does not execute trades or hold custody.
- Not real-time. Quotes and fundamentals refresh daily; intraday prices are delayed.
